SOAS College recently launched its’ National English Essay Writing Competition.
The competition which is open to all secondary students in government schools in Brunei hopes to encourage students to engage with important issues using the medium of English.

Ms. Brenda Low, SCB Head of Consumer Transaction Banking handing over the prizes to SOAS College Project Manager, Mr. Fahim Docrat, joined by SOAS College Senior Master Md Zulhisham Bin Hj Napiah and Ms. Jennifer Kang, SCB Head of Corporate Affairs and Marketing.
Standard Chartered Bank Brunei has pledged their support for this competition by sponsoring the prizes which includes, an i-touch, i-pods, cash savings accounts and goodie bags.
The prizes are worth BND2000.
Project Manager for the SOAS College National English Essay Writing Competition, Mr. Fahim Docrat said, "We thank Standard Chartered Bank for their support which highlights the important role that the private sector plays in ensuring that our youth are given every opportunity to excel and make a positive contribution to society."
“We would like to commend SOAS College on hosting this National English Essay Writing Competition on the topic- The Year 2035. This is indeed a great initiative to engage students and very topical for them to understand the importance of sustainability. At Standard Chartered Bank, building a sustainable business is important to us. We operate in a rapidly changing world, with multiple stakeholders, and global challenges, such as climate change and poverty. Building a sustainable business is our response to these issues – ensuring we have a positive long-term impact on the world and to continue to be high performing. We are delighted to support this competition that will help the students to also better embrace the sustainability concept and bring about good thoughts and ideas for a better tomorrow,” said Brenda Low, Standard Chartered Bank Head of Consumer Transaction Banking.
